Anjali Mudra
- Made with two hands joined vertically in front of the chest, as in the attitude of prayer.
- Evokes an offering of good feelings of one towards another
- Also indicates veneration if it is made at the level of the face
- This Mudra is reserved for praying figures – which often accompany a statue of the Buddha in the art of India or South East Asia.
